Top findings

Six themes, one story.

Ranked by signal strength across all segments, the findings converge on a single point: vendors do the work, then fight to get paid and stay compliant.

1

Late payment is the #1 problem in every segment

51.6% of clients paying late outranks processing fees (22.1%) and scope disputes (18.9%). It isn’t a paperwork problem, it's a structural cash flow problem, and the smallest vendors feel it most.

2

Negotiating payment terms is the hardest part of onboarding

29% of respondents say payment negotiation is harder than filing paperwork (24%) and portal learning curves as the toughest part of taking on a new client.

3

Fewer portals don’t mean less administrative work

Nearly half of the respondents log into just 1–2 portals a month, yet more than 60% still lose 2–10 hours a week to portal administration.

4

Many vendors still haven’t adopted accounting software

58.5% use QuickBooks, making it the leading accounting platform. Yet 26.1% still rely on pen, paper, or spreadsheets.

5

Compliance paperwork is a hidden, recurring drain

Only 26% of respondents spend less than one hour per month on compliance-related tasks, while 12% spend more than nine hours.

6

Roughly 1 in 6 vendors wait 31+ days to get paid

A majority (57%) are paid within 15 days, 17% are waiting 31–90 days.
